Multiple hens will lay eggs in other Wood Ducks nests, sometimes other species will lay eggs in other Wood Duck nests. I have had 35-40 eggs in one nesting box, aka a "dump box". I used to think it was a bad thing due to poor nesting box placement but now I believe nature has a way of making sure species survival should the sitting hens eggs not be viable.That was cool.
